Ex- Doctor Charged with Sexual Assault Allegations Involving 38 Individuals in His Care

Prosecutors have announced that a ex- physician now faces charges for carrying out sexual assaults involving 38 victims who were under his care.

Details of the Grave Allegations

Nathaniel Spencer from Birmingham is accused of dozens of sexual offences – comprising some against children younger than 13 – between 2017 to 2021.

A deputy chief CPS official said, “Our prosecutors have worked at length to assist a detailed and complex police inquiry, carefully reviewing the evidence to establish that there is sufficient evidence to bring the case to trial and that it is in the public interest.”

The Investigation

These allegations come after what investigators called a “complex investigation” into reported assaults at two hospitals: a hospital in Stoke-on-Trent and Russells Hall hospital.

The defendant is scheduled to appear at the North Staffordshire justice centre on January 20th.

List of Charges

The charging documents outline the forty-five sexual offences he is charged with:

  • 15 counts of sexual assault.
  • 17 counts of penetrative assault.
  • 9 counts of assault on a minor under thirteen.
  • Three counts of assault of a child under 13 by penetration.
  • One count of attempted penetrative assault.

Police have asked anyone with concerns to contact the investigating team.
